Step 4 — Enable the stale-branch cleanup bot (Tidyvine)

After the release candidate is tagged, activate Tidyvine so it can sweep branches older than 30 days from the Fernhollow repo. The bot runs as a scheduled job and only needs its env file in place before the first cycle. Copy `tidyvine.env.example` to `tidyvine.env`, set the dry-run flag to false, then add the bot's auth token on the next line.

vault entry, kagep-yajeg: COURIER_KEY5=da097

# Break-Glass Access — Wavelet Preview Service

Contractors: the Murmuring audio waveform preview renderer normally requires team-lead approval. In an outage, break-glass access lets you restart the render pool directly. Use it only when previews are down platform-wide, and log your session afterward. To activate break-glass mode, enter the recovery passphrase shown below.

recovery phrase for bawep-kawef: oliath-casdor

Quarterly Planning Note — Branch Managers

Q2 cash-flow forecast for Marrowgate Retail: inflows flat, outflows up 6% on lease renewals and the Selby depot refit. Net position tightens mid-quarter; expect stricter purchase approvals from week five. Hold discretionary spend, chase overdue accounts hard, and submit cash reports weekly, not monthly. No branch-level capex without district sign-off. Implications for next year's direction are set out in the confidential note below.

confidential, yahip-hagug: Gorixax Logistics plans to lower the Ulaael list price by 26.6 percent in October. The pricing group signed off on a budget of $199.9 million for Project Holix. The renewal with Kasdorox Systems closes at $137.5 million a year, 8.2 percent above the last contract. Project Lamion slips by a full year because of the audit delay.

Handover Note — Ashgrove Lease

From D. Pellan to S. Ruiz, for circulation to sales leads.

Renegotiation of the Ashgrove showroom lease is midway. Landlord has conceded a two-year break clause; rate reduction of 8% is still contested. Keep client visits scheduled there as normal to avoid signalling. Our negotiating position rests on the plans noted below.

confidential, kagup-bafog: Fraaxax Group is in early talks to buy Soroxox Group for about $343.8 million. The Olidor launch date is June 14, and nothing goes to the press before then. Legal wants the Aldmirek Logistics term sheet signed before July 23.